Because the rest of the choices are the right or the main periods of the greek sculpture.The Archaic period is the earliest period which started around 600 B.C. and lasted until 480 B.C. The Classical the second period of greek sculpture between the Archaic and Hellenistic times. This period shows a very large shift from the stiff Archaic to a more realistic and sometimes idealistic portrayal of the human figure. Then the Hellenistic the third period started little before 300 B.C. to the average person, it is very difficult to see the distinction between the Classical and Hellenistic periods.

Johann Christian Bach was a galant-style German composer of Italian opera during the early Classical period, and the youngest son of famed Baroque composer Johann Sebastian Bach.
